Description
Welcome to Crome Road, Great Barr!
Offered with no upward chain, this beautifully presented three-bedroom semi-detached home is located in the sought-after area of Crome Road, Great Barr. Boasting a turnkey style, this property is ready for immediate occupation, ideal for first-time buyers and families.
The home begins with a spacious entrance porch leading into a welcoming hallway. To the front, the lounge features a large bay window, allowing for plenty of natural light. To the rear, the modern kitchen/dining area offers a contemporary finish, complete with plumbing for a washing machine and dishwasher, undercounter space for a tumble dryer, and room for a tall fridge/freezer. White goods may be available via separate negotiation.
Upstairs, you will find three well-proportioned bedrooms and a modern family bathroom with a shower over the bath. The property benefits from gas central heating, double glazing throughout, and a freehold title.
Externally, there is a paved driveway to the front providing off-road parking for multiple vehicles. The rear garden is low-maintenance, featuring a decking area and artificial lawn, perfect for relaxing or entertaining.
Situated in a sought after, residential area, Crome Road is conveniently located close to a range of local amenities including schools, shops, and public transport links. Great Barr offers excellent road access to the M6 and M5 motorways, making it ideal for commuters. The area also benefits from nearby parks and green spaces, perfect for family walks or outdoor activities.
